PAST-HOAS: Fast Setup of Per-Address Sink Routing Trees by Reverse Flooding

Scaling Ethernet switched networks to sizes of hundreds of thousands of hosts is a key requirement for data center networks. PAST is a simple and scalable OpenFlow-based layer-two architecture for data center Ethernet networks that outperforms Equal Cost Multipath Forwarding. PAST computes and configures one spanning tree for every MAC destination address. However, an important bottleneck of PAST is the time taken to perform the massive installation of rules at OpenFlow switches to set up the trees. PAST-HOAS aims to solve that obstacle, building trees instantly by path discovery, either triggered by the controller with a multicast probe frame from the edge destination switch or by the standard ARP Request frame; without flow installation and without tree computation. PASTHOAS is loop-free, and provides 100–400 times faster network initialization, lower forwarding delays and increased robustness and scalability.

[1]  Keqiang He,et al.  Presto: Edge-based Load Balancing for Fast Datacenter Networks , 2015, Conference on Applications, Technologies, Architectures, and Protocols for Computer Communication.

[2]  Elisa Rojas,et al.  All-Path bridging: Path exploration protocols for data center and campus networks , 2015, Comput. Networks.

[3]  Alan L. Cox,et al.  PAST: scalable ethernet for data centers , 2012, CoNEXT '12.

[4]  Sanjay Ghemawat,et al.  MapReduce: Simplified Data Processing on Large Clusters , 2004, OSDI.

[5]  Elisa Rojas,et al.  New cooperative mechanisms for software defined networks based on hybrid switches , 2017, Trans. Emerg. Telecommun. Technol..

[6]  Diego Lopez-Pajares,et al.  TCP-path: Improving load balance by network exploration , 2017, 2017 IEEE 6th International Conference on Cloud Networking (CloudNet).

[7]  Elisa Rojas,et al.  Implementation of ARP-path low latency bridges in Linux and OpenFlow/NetFPGA , 2011, 2011 IEEE 12th International Conference on High Performance Switching and Routing.

[8]  Jeffrey C. Mogul,et al.  NetLord: a scalable multi-tenant network architecture for virtualized datacenters , 2011, SIGCOMM 2011.

[9]  George Varghese,et al.  CONGA: distributed congestion-aware load balancing for datacenters , 2015, SIGCOMM.

[10]  Thomas Dietz,et al.  A Small Data Center Network of ARP-Path Bridges made of Openflow Switches , 2011 .

[11]  David A. Maltz,et al.  Data center TCP (DCTCP) , 2010, SIGCOMM 2010.